Apollo 15—July 26–August 7, 1971. Apollo 15 was the first mission to use the lunar rover. The three astronauts on Apollo 15 were David Scott, James Irwin, and Alfred Worden. Scott and Irwin each spent 18 hours and 40 minutes on the surface of the Moon. WebThe first Apollo mission to get to space was Apollo 7. During the 11-day flight, the crew conducted a number of tests on the spacecraft systems and conducted the first live TV program from an American spacecraft. All three crewmembers – Wally Schirra, Walt Cunningham and Donn Eisele – developed bad head colds during the mission. WebAstronauts Virgil Grissom, Edward White, and Roger Chaffee lost their lives when a fire swept through the Command Module (CM). The exhaustive investigation of the fire and extensive reworking of the CMs postponed any manned launch until NASA officials cleared the CM for manned flight.
